How much does a Chief Information Officer make?

The average salary for a Chief Information Officer is $187,021 per year in the US.

A Chief Information Officer (CIO) plays a key role in a company's technology strategy. They lead the IT department and ensure that technology supports business goals. The average yearly salary for a CIO is around $187,000. This high salary reflects the importance of their work and the responsibility they carry.

CIOs earn different salaries based on their experience and the size of the company. The lowest 10% of CIOs make about $80,000 a year. The top 10% earn more than $380,000 annually. These figures show that there is a lot of potential for growth in this career. Companies with more resources and higher budgets often offer higher salaries to attract top talent. This means that experienced CIOs can earn even more as they move up in their careers.

What are the highest paying cities for a Chief Information Officer?

Seattle, WA, offers the highest average salary for Chief Information Officers at $255,308. This city's tech industry and major companies attract top talent. Sacramento, CA, follows closely with an average salary of $238,414. Washington, DC, provides a competitive average salary of $202,124. This city's government sector and political influence create strong demand for skilled IT leaders. Austin, TX, Austin, TX, offers a solid average salary of $159,798, driven by its growing tech scene.
